#ecc1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ecc1ff is composed of 92.5% red, 75.7%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.5%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 281.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 87.8%. #ecc1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d983ff.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

#ecc1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ecc1ff has RGB values of R:236, G:193,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 15516159.

Shades and Tints of #ecc1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0010 is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.
